Output 2627ab15f60c36b3a8744ecb59c67a3aa4923e13a819aa4ec8ac645ee68998f7:1

value
31200574
script pubkey
OP_0 OP_PUSHBYTES_20 d4133a26252fba065d21ad05b4ef84125b83fb4a
address
bc1q6sfn5f3997aqvhfp45zmfmuyzfdc8762wgf5e7
transaction
2627ab15f60c36b3a8744ecb59c67a3aa4923e13a819aa4ec8ac645ee68998f7